云题海 - 专业文章范例文档资料分享平台

当前位置:首页 > 微机原理2009练习题答案 - 1263013201

微机原理2009练习题答案 - 1263013201

  • 62 次阅读
  • 3 次下载
  • 2025/6/14 16:11:25

A. EPROM B. DRAM C. SRAM D. EEPROM

23、、可编程并行接口芯片8255的PA口,PB口允许中断是通过(C ). A.向PC口地址写入C口置位/复位字 B.控制口写方式控制字 C.向控制口写入C口置位/复位字 D.向PA PB口写入控制字在 24.用6116组成32KB的存储器空间需要数量( B ). A、8片 B、16片 C、24片 D、32片 25.指令 CALL DWORD PTR [BX][SI] 调用方式为( D ). A. 段内直接调用 B. 段间直接调用

C. 段内间接调用 D. 段间间接调用 26.定义过程的伪指令是(C )

A. ASSUME B. SEGMENT/ENDS C. PROC/ENDP D. EXTRN 27.定义段寄存器的伪指令是(A )

A. ASSUME B. SEGMENT/ENDS C. PROC/ENDP D. EXTRN 28.指令 DEC

BX 始终不影响(A ) 状态标志

A. CF B. AF C. SF D.ZF 29. 执行指令 STD

CMPSW 自动完成地址指针的(C )的功能。 A. SI=SI+1 DI=DI+1 B. SI=SI+2 DI=DI+2 C. SI=SI-2 DI=DI-2 D. SI=SI-1 DI=DI-1

30.DOS系统功能调用,要显示一个字符串的功能号和字符串偏移地址存放的寄存器为(DA. 01H DI B. 02H BX C. 0AH SI D. 09H DX

31、8086 CPU一般情况可作为计数器的寄存器是(C ). A、SS B、DX C、CX D、BP

32、用2764的存储器芯片组成256KB的存储器空间需要数量(D ). A、8片 B、16片 C、24片 D、32片 33、下面四种中断优先级最高的是(D ).

A、单步中断 B、INTR中断 C、NMI中断 D、INT 10H

34、若8086执行一条ADD AL,BL指令后,OF=1,则表明结果是( D ).

A、结果>255 B、127 > 结果 > -128 C、为负数 D、127 < 结果或 < -128

5

35、8253可采用硬件启动计数方式为(D)

A. 1,5 B. 0,4 C. 0,2,3,4 D.1,2,3,5

36、PC/XT 8086微机系统 IOW、IOR 信号是由(B )提供。

A、8284 B、8288 C、8286 D、8086

37、8086 CPU驱动与存储器传送数据的总线周期一般为( C ) 个时钟周期组成.

A、6个 B、8个 C、4个 D、5个

38、当8086 CPU访问存储器的地址为0020:3000H单元时,其物理地址是( A ). A、03200H B、30020H C、02300H D、00230H

39、设两个字的数据 87654321H 存储在起始地址为23000H的内存单元中,则本23002H单元中存储的数据为

(D ).

A、87H B、21H C、43H D、65H 40、3片8259级联可提供的中断类型码最多是(B ).

A、24个 B、22个 C、8个 D、16个

41、8253工作于方式2 正在进行计数时,( D )引脚的低电平信号能使其停止工作. A、CLK B、OUT C、A0 D、GATE

42、可编程并行接口芯片8255可工作于方式0、1、2三种方式的端口为(A ) A. 只有PA口 B. PA口和PB口 C. PA,PB,PC口均可 D. 只有PB口 43.执行指令 CLD

MOVSW 自动完成地址指针的(B )的功能。 A. SI=SI+1 DI=DI+1 B. SI=SI+2 DI=DI+2 C. SI=SI-2 DI=DI-2 D. SI=SI-1 DI=DI-1 三、1 判断题 ( 对的打√, 错的打×并改正 ) <1>、8253端口有一个偶地址和一个奇地址.( × )

<2>、存储器代码段管理的逻辑地址是由 CPU内部的ES段寄存器提供的.( × ) <3>、8255的PA口.PB口.PC口都可设定工作在方式0.方式1和方式2三种方式. (× ) <4>、执行指令 MUL BX结果放在AX中。( × ) <5>、执行 \后,使SP=SP-4.( × )

<6>、8259的内部寄存器只有一个偶地址和一个奇地.( √ )

<7>、存储器附加段管理的物理地址只能由 CPU内部的ES 和 DI寄存器提供的.( √ )

6

<8>、8255的PA口可设定工作在方式0.方式1和方式2三种方式. ( √ ) <9>、执行指令 MUL BL结果放在AX中。( √ ) <10>、执行 \后,使SP=SP-6.( √ ) <11>. IN 200H, AL ×

<12>. DIV AX , 5

(×)

<13>. MOV BYTE PTR [BX], 256 (×) <14>. MOV ES,6000H (×)

<15> SAL AL, 2(×) <16> DATA1 DB 56,786BH…(×)

<17> LOOP CX ,NEXT (×) <18> MOV [DX],2000H (×) <19>. LEA DI, AX (×) <20>. PUSH CH (×) <21> MOV

[2500H],[BX+SI] (×)

<22> INC [BX+50H] (×)

<23> MUL 56H (×) <24> OUT DX,AL (√) <25> JMP BYTE PTR [DI] (×) <26> MOV CS,BX (×) <27> POP CS (×) <28> MOV AL,BX (×) 四、 阅读程序并分析结果: 1. MOV AL, 43H MOV BL,

35H

ADD AL,BL DAA MOV DL,BL SHL DL,1 1;最高位移到CF

HLT

AL= 78 DL= 6AH BL= 35 AH= 00H CF=0

2. MOV AL, 80H

MOV BL,

92H

7

MOV CL, 0 ADD AL, BL

JNC

LAB

NOT CL

LAB: HLT

AL= 12H BL= 92H CL= FFH CF= 1 3.分析下面程序的功能。

LEA

SI,DATA1

MOV CX,200 MOV

AL,[SI]

INC SI DEC CX NEXT: CMP AL,[SI] JL

LOP1

MOV AL,[SI] LOP1: INC

SI LOOP

NEXT

答:找出内存变量DATA1中连续存放的200个有符号号数的最小的存放在AL中4.分析下面程序的功能。

LEA

BX,BCD-BUF

MOV AL,[BX] INC

BX

ADD AL,[BX]

DAA

INC BX

MOV

[BX],AL

8

搜索更多关于: 微机原理2009练习题答案 - 1263013201 的文档
  • 收藏
  • 违规举报
  • 版权认领
下载文档10.00 元 加入VIP免费下载
推荐下载
本文作者:...

共分享92篇相关文档

文档简介:

A. EPROM B. DRAM C. SRAM D. EEPROM 23、、可编程并行接口芯片8255的PA口,PB口允许中断是通过(C ). A.向PC口地址写入C口置位/复位字 B.控制口写方式控制字 C.向控制口写入C口置位/复位字 D.向PA PB口写入控制字在 24.用6116组成32KB的存储器空间需要数量( B ). A、8片 B、16片 C、24片 D、32片 25.指令 CALL DWORD PTR [BX][SI] 调用方式为( D ). A. 段内直接调用 B. 段间直接调用 C. 段内间接调用 D. 段间间接调用 26.定义过程的伪指令是(C ) A.

× 游客快捷下载通道(下载后可以自由复制和排版)
单篇付费下载
限时特价:10 元/份 原价:20元
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
VIP包月下载
特价:29 元/月 原价:99元
低至 0.3 元/份 每月下载150
全站内容免费自由复制
注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信:fanwen365 QQ:370150219
Copyright © 云题海 All Rights Reserved. 苏ICP备16052595号-3 网站地图 客服QQ:370150219 邮箱:370150219@qq.com